c++杨辉三角代码怎么写

   2024-10-20 2670
核心提示:#include using namespace std;int main() {int numRows;coutEnter the number of rows for Pascal's Triangle: ;cinnumRows;int

#include using namespace std;

int main() {int numRows;

cout << "Enter the number of rows for Pascal's Triangle: ";cin >> numRows;int triangle[numRows][numRows];for (int i = 0; i < numRows; i++) {    triangle[i][0] = 1;    triangle[i][i] = 1;}for (int i = 2; i < numRows; i++) {    for (int j = 1; j < i; j++) {        triangle[i][j] = triangle[i-1][j-1] + triangle[i-1][j];    }}cout << "Pascal's Triangle:" << endl;for (int i = 0; i < numRows; i++) {    for (int j = 0; j <= i; j++) {        cout << triangle[i][j] << " ";    }    cout << endl;}return 0;

}

 
举报打赏
 
更多>同类网点查询
推荐图文
推荐网点查询
点击排行

网站首页  |  关于我们  |  联系方式网站留言    |  赣ICP备2021007278号